Diamond is not particularly hard to identify (if the alternatives are quartz and glass), there wasn’t really any need to take it to a jeweller. If you’ve “studied rocks” as you claim you should have easily been able to identify it yourself.

That aside, I kind of doubt that it’s a diamond just from the size. Diamonds the size of half a fist are incredibly rare and would be noticed pretty easily if they were just lying around. It also depends on where you found it, gem quality diamonds are restricted entirely to kimberlite and lamproite intrusions so if where you found it is not within one of those then it’s highly unlikely to be a diamond.

You could get it tested somewhere else, you could also just try scratching it with a piece of quartz (which if it doesn’t scratch would eliminate both glass and quartz as possibilities). Another thing you could do (and yes this does sound wierd) is put it in your mouth, diamond has a very high heat capacity and thermal conductivity so it should feel cold. It’s also very good at repelling water and sticks to grease and oil, a common way of sorting diamonds in industry is using a grease pan, the diamonds stick and everything else doesn’t.

Like I said before, I seriously doubt it’s diamond but if you feel that strongly about it then go and ask them to give the chunk back.

Liberals Will Destroy America said “it most likely was glass as diamonds are hard and do not break easily and it is very doubtful that is was a diamond”

This statement is wrong. Diamond is very hard but that does not relate to how easy it is to break. It is difficult to scratch it but it cleaves fairly easily so a blunt impact would be able to fairly easily dislodge a chunk.
